Breyer Family Foundation is located in Palo Alto, CA. The organization was established in 2015. According to its NTEE Classification (T20) the organization is classified as: Private Grantmaking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Breyer Family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Breyer Family Foundation generated $1.9m in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 8 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(19.0%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$3.4m during the year ending 12/2022. Since 2015, Breyer Family Foundation has awarded 89 individual grants totaling $20,932,933. If you would like to learn more about the grant giving history of this organization, scroll down to the grant profile section of this page.
